Hello, and welcome to my fifth Groupmuse!
Please join me for a joyful evening of music by composers who were famous harpsichord players in their own spheres, including: J.S. Bach in Germany; Élisabeth Jacquet de La Guerre in France; G.F. Handel in England; and Domenico Scarlatti in Spain.
All of the music will be performed on a 17th-century Flemish-style replica harpsichord.
What's the music?
Élisabeth Jacquet de La Guerre - Suite in F from Pièces de clavecin (1687)
J.S. Bach - English Suite in F major
- intermission -
G.F. Handel - Suite in A major (1720)
Domenico Scarlatti - Sonatas (various)
